From my experience with this router I have been unable to flash it with my windows machine. NMRPFlash simply doesn't catch the router at boot. However from my raspberry pi running ubuntu or kali I am able to use NMRPFlash.
I have to be plugged into the LAN1 port (port right next to the WAN port), and have all other RJ45 plugs disconnected.
I hope this helps someone somehow. Perhaps WSL would resolve the issue I had on Windows? I did have winpcap and wireshark and all those goodies on my windows machine but NOTHING would flash the router back to stock except my linux raspberry pi 4
